My Windows 10 has a funny issue. I can live with it, but it's annoying, I've accidentally closed the wrong program many times thanks to it.
Sometimes Windows will act as if I pressed Alt+Tab when I press Ctrl, throwing me back to the last active window, then it finishes executing whatever shortcut I was performing on that window. That happens when I'm in the middle of a shortcut like Ctrl+C/V, Ctrl+S, Ctrl+A or even Ctrl+W (thanks satan!). I'm not sure if it also happens when pressing Ctrl alone since I don't often do it.
I have no idea what's causing it. At first I suspected it was an AutoHotkey script I wrote to rebind keys but it happens on fresh reboots without the script running. It happens at random, in multiple programs such as Notepad and internet browsers, and I don't know how to reproduce it reliably.
